#include "components/sync/model/entity_data.h"
#include "components/sync/base/model_type.h"
#include "components/sync/base/unique_position.h"
#include "testing/gtest/include/gtest/gtest.h"
namespace syncer {
class EntityDataTest : public testing::Test {
protected:
EntityDataTest() {}
~EntityDataTest() override {}
};
TEST_F(EntityDataTest, IsDeleted) {
EntityData data;
EXPECT_TRUE(data.is_deleted());
AddDefaultFieldValue(BOOKMARKS, &data.specifics);
EXPECT_FALSE(data.is_deleted());
}
TEST_F(EntityDataTest, Swap) {
EntityData data;
AddDefaultFieldValue(BOOKMARKS, &data.specifics);
data.id = "id";
data.server_defined_unique_tag = "server_defined_unique_tag";
data.client_tag_hash = "client_tag_hash";
data.non_unique_name = "non_unique_name";
data.creation_time = base::Time::FromTimeT(10);
data.modification_time = base::Time::FromTimeT(20);
data.parent_id = "parent_id";
data.is_folder = true;
UniquePosition unique_position =
UniquePosition::InitialPosition(UniquePosition::RandomSuffix());
data.unique_position = unique_position.ToProto();
// Remember addresses of some data within EntitySpecific and UniquePosition
// to make sure that the underlying data isn't copied.
const sync_pb::BookmarkSpecifics* bookmark_specifics =
&data.specifics.bookmark();
const std::string* unique_position_value = &data.unique_position.value();
EntityDataPtr ptr(data.PassToPtr());
// Compare addresses of the data wrapped by EntityDataPtr to make sure that
// the underlying objects are exactly the same.
EXPECT_EQ(bookmark_specifics, &ptr->specifics.bookmark());
EXPECT_EQ(unique_position_value, &ptr->unique_position.value());
// Compare other fields.
EXPECT_EQ("id", ptr->id);
EXPECT_EQ("server_defined_unique_tag", ptr->server_defined_unique_tag);
EXPECT_EQ("client_tag_hash", ptr->client_tag_hash);
EXPECT_EQ("non_unique_name", ptr->non_unique_name);
EXPECT_EQ("parent_id", ptr->parent_id);
EXPECT_EQ(base::Time::FromTimeT(10), ptr->creation_time);
EXPECT_EQ(base::Time::FromTimeT(20), ptr->modification_time);
EXPECT_EQ(true, ptr->is_folder);
EXPECT_EQ(false, data.is_folder);
}
} // namespace syncer
